Sacramento Kings make bold move, inserting Russell Westbrook into starting lineup

The Sacramento Kings are in the midst of a challenging stretch, having dropped four consecutive games leading up to their crucial NBA Cup matchup with the Minnesota Timberwolves. With a disappointing record of 3-9, the Kings have struggled to find consistency and positive momentum this season. Yet amidst the turmoil, veteran point guard Russell Westbrook has emerged as a notable bright spot for the team.

Westbrook’s Impact on the Kings

Over the first 12 games of the season, Westbrook has showcased his skill set and leadership, earning him the attention and admiration of both fans and coaching staff. His performances have sparked discussions about potential changes in the lineup, and it appears those conversations have reached a tipping point. Head coach Doug Christie has taken a significant step by deciding to shake up the starting five.

A Shift in Strategy

In a move that many fans have been clamoring for, the Kings are set to start Russell Westbrook in their game against the Timberwolves. This decision comes at the expense of Dennis Schröder, who will transition to the second unit. The change reflects a strategic pivot aimed at revitalizing the team’s performance and injecting new life into their play.
